The Metropolitan Police is trialling new ‘Sandcat’ armoured vehicles across London – which are manufactured by Israeli armoured vehicle company Plasan. For more than thirty years, Plasan has supplied these systems to the Israeli military, including around seven hundred ‘Sandcats’ since the beginning of Israel’s genocide in Gaza.
A Met spokesperson said the eighteen vehicles it has bought from Plasan will be used to suppress ‘serious public disorder’ and will replace its fleet of ‘Jankel’ armoured cars, according to reports in The New Arab.
Israeli arms companies frequently use the deployment of their weapons in Gaza as a sales tool, boasting that they are ‘battle tested’ after being used against Palestinians.
